About this Event

Dark Dazey is an independent, LA-based psych-rock band with a flare for genre bending. Together, this council of audio fiends and soundscape magicians fuse aesthetics from metal, punk, jazz, and country seamlessly into a modern and unique psychedelic rock framework.

They excel on the live stage, breathing new life into their lush studio recordings and roping the audience in on the way. Count on beautiful and often haunting harmonies, face melting guitar riffs, and high intensity jams all in the spirit of theatrical fun. Throughout the show, Dazey invites the audience aboard for any number of communal activities from clapping and crouching to demonic chanting and sticking it to the NRA. It’s groovy, boisterous, and no one is having more fun than the band.



Goodworld is an independent rock band based out of San Francisco, CA. The band’s sound is a mix of Nate Budroe’s singer songwriter sensibilities and Oscar Dan Pratt’s rambling blues guitar. The band aims to delight and confuse listeners with their witty lyrics and musical folly. A healthy mix of blues, rock, country, and indie, Goodworld’s self titled album deputed in 2022. Every show brings something new, as Nate and Oscar on a stage together can never disappoint. Join Goodworld in the idea that the world is fundamental goodness…or an above average theme park.


Mild Universe is a San Francisco based collective crafting dreamy dance music. Their debut self titled EP is full of genre-bending, energetic dance anthems with simple, repetitive lyrics that are an homage to 90’s club music, with a disco-era instrumental feel. Mild Universe aims to unite communities through music and movement.
